As someone who has been through the final stages of college, I can truly relate to the mix of excitement and stress that comes with having just a couple of classes left before graduation. It feels like you’ve been grinding non-stop, juggling assignments, exams, and sometimes even part-time jobs or internships. One of the key tips I found helpful during this time was effective time management. Breaking down your remaining coursework into manageable chunks and setting realistic deadlines created a sense of accomplishment with every task completed. Additionally, staying connected with classmates and professors helped me clarify expectations and gather support when needed. Balancing academic responsibilities while preparing for life after college can be overwhelming. I recommend investing time in career planning by attending campus career fairs, updating your resume, and exploring job or graduate school opportunities early. These efforts reduce anxiety about what’s next once the degree is in hand. Moreover, don’t forget to take care of your well-being. Short breaks, physical activity, or even simply spending time with friends can significantly reduce stress and keep your motivation intact. Graduating is a huge milestone that marks the end of one chapter and the beginning of another. Cherish these last moments of college life by reflecting on your growth and accomplishments. Remember, the grind truly doesn’t stop, but with perseverance and a positive mindset, you can finish strong and confidently step into your future.
